It best reflects the principle of "communication is irreversible and unrepeatable".
Communication winds up irreversible in light of the fact that once you said something or do a few gestures you can't take it back. You can be sad the same number of times as you need. Be that as it may, it doesn't imply that what you did or said will be disposed off from the life of the other individual. That is the reason when individuals are angry, they must think many times before saying something they lament after.

I believe the answer is: a member of the bourgeoisie
bourgeoisie refers to the group of people that own large number of capital or materialistic value within a society. These group of people tend to consist of people who had enough power to influence the decision made by the society (such as influencing the outcome of election, making government officials pass a certain legislation, etc)
